Company Overview

Robinhood Markets, Inc. (NASDAQ: HOOD) is a financial services company that pioneered commission-free trading through a mobile-first platform. Established in 2013 and headquartered in Menlo Park, California, Robinhood was founded by Vlad Tenev and Baiju Bhatt with the stated mission of democratizing access to the financial markets. The platform rapidly gained popularity for its intuitive interface and zero-commission trades, disrupting traditional brokerage models and attracting millions of retail investors.

The company’s core offerings include equity and exchange-traded fund (ETF) trading, options trading, and cryptocurrency trading through its Robinhood Crypto business. In addition to zero-fee trades, Robinhood provides fractional shares, enabling users to invest in high-priced stocks with minimal capital. Cash management services are available via the Robinhood Cash Card, a debit card that integrates with brokerage accounts to earn interest on uninvested cash balances. For more active traders, the Robinhood Gold subscription offers enhanced margin borrowing, access to professional research reports, and larger instant deposit limits.

While Robinhood primarily serves retail customers across the United States, it has explored international expansion in Europe and Asia. The company operates under regulatory oversight from the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C), the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A), and is a member of the Securities Investor Protection Corporation (SIPC). Robinhood has also taken steps to enhance its educational resources and customer support following periods of rapid growth and heightened market volatility.

Leadership at Robinhood Markets remains closely tied to its founders, with Vlad Tenev serving as Chief Executive Officer and Baiju Bhatt as a board member. The executive team includes seasoned professionals overseeing operations, compliance, engineering, and product development. Through continuous platform enhancements and an expanding suite of financial tools, Robinhood aims to maintain its position as a leading innovator in the retail brokerage industry.

Robinhood Markets, Inc. (NASDAQ:HOOD) released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April, 30th. The company reported $0.37 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.41 by $0.04.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 50.0% compared to the same quarter last year.

Robinhood Markets (HOOD) raised $2.2 billion in an initial public offering (IPO) on Thursday, July 29th 2021. The company issued 55,000,000 shares at a price of $38.00-$42.00 per share. Goldman Sachs, J.P. Morgan, Barclays, Citigroup and Wells Fargo Securities acted as the underwriters for the IPO and Mizuho Securities, JMP Securities, Piper Sandler, KeyBanc Capital Markets, Rosenblatt Securities, BMO Capital Markets, BTIG, Santander, Academy Securities, Loop Capital Markets, Ramirez & Co. and Siebert Williams Shank were co-managers.
